Deformation and Failure Charateristics of Tunnel Excavation Based on GPU Accelerated Random Field

Abstract

The random distribution of parameter of the surrounding rock have obvious effect on the stability and this paper investigates the influence of the random spatial distribution of rock mass parameters on the stability of surrounding rock. A random field generation method based on the covariance matrix decomposition and GPU acceleration method is proposed. A function that transforms the random field to IMASS constitutive model parameter were successfully established. Afterwards, the effect of the random field under different conditions and the influence on the subsequent simulated excavation were compared. The results show that the random field generated by the Exp correlation function is relatively stable and scattered, and its maximum displacement value varies within a small range; the random field generated by the SExp correlation function is more compact, with a larger fluctuation range of the maximum displacement value, and more dangerous displacements occur occasionally. It can be found from the X, Y correlation length that the distribution of the maximum displacement points is similar. During excavation, the middle, bottom and vault on both sides of the chamber are dangerous areas, and the damage locations are mainly concentrated in the cavern side wall, the junction of the vault and the middle of the side wall.
